STAYING ONE STEP AHEAD WITH PRE-FABRICATION
Pre-fabrication is one of the many ways we work smarter for our clients and our crews. By planning ahead and building plumbing systems in a controlled shop environment, we’re able to improve accuracy, reduce waste, and keep projects moving efficiently from start to finish. The result is faster installs, cleaner jobsites, and a level of consistency and quality that reflects the pride we take in our work.
It’s all about setting our field teams up for success every day.

CUTTING
Our pre-fabrication process starts with precise pipe cutting based on coordinated models and detailed spool drawings. By cutting everything in-house with state-of-the-art equipment and to exact dimensions, we eliminate field guesswork, reduce material waste, and ensure every piece is right the first time. This controlled shop process allows us to maintain consistent quality across the system and keep installations moving efficiently in the field.

ASSEMBLY
After cutting, pipe is assembled into "spools" in our shop using clearly labeled spool sheets that show exactly how each piece fits together. Our team builds out fittings, valves, and hangers to match the design, completing as much work as possible before it ever reaches the jobsite. This improves safety, speeds up installation, and ensures a consistent level of craftsmanship, with every spool checked for accuracy before it’s sent to the field.

DELIVERY
Once assembled, spools are palletized and organized for delivery to the jobsite. Our delivery teams stage them exactly where they’ll be installed, reducing handling and congestion on site. With pipe already cut, labeled, and partially assembled, crews can install faster and more efficiently—keeping projects clean and on schedule.
